Kuttikrishnan (Jagadish), the illicit son of businessman Ananthan Nambiar, comes to Kochi to meet his dad, but a mix-up leaves him on the streets & another young man, Balagopalan (Mukesh), in his place as Nambiar's son. To expose Balagopalan, Kuttikrishnan teams up with cutpurse Mukundan (Jagathi) & car-thief Meenakshi (Annie), both of whom ensconce themselves in Nambiar's house as Kuttikrishnan's relatives. Meanwhile, Nambiar's manager Krishnadas was plotting to usurp Nambiar's assets.

Vishnu is the regional manager in a travels company and he is a bachelor. His friends and relatives try to get him to be married, but Vishnu has seven conditions for his future wife, including strange ones such as knowing Carnatic music, Hindi, and Chinese and Western cooking. So his friend Krishnankutty does many cunning things to make Vishnu get married to Lathika. After that, they both get married. But the real problems begin there.

A singer Pappan (Rahman) is killed in a bike accident, but Yamaraj the Lord of Death (Thilakan) realizes that Pappan has a few more days to live. Yamarajan allows Pappan to enter into bodies of other dead people including that of Inspector Devdas (Mohanlal) in a bid to tell his girlfriend Sarina (Lizy) that Pappan is dead, and to look forward to someone else in life.

Raman Nair (Innocent) is a miserly business man who is overbearing on his sons, Rameshan (Dileep) and Ramanan (Ashokan). After both of them get married, problems start to creep into the household and Raman's solution is to get married again. Things take a turn again after Gundur Parvathi (Kalpana) comes into their lives as Rameshan's and Ramanan's step-mother.
